A Platform Trial for Pediatric Participants With Obesity or Overweight (LY900040)
NCT06672549 · Recruiting
Last updated 2026-05-28This clinical trial is testing different investigational treatments in children and adolescents who are overweight or have obesity to see how they respond to each option.

Description as written by the study sponsor.
The purpose of this pediatric, chronic weight management, Phase 3 Master Protocol (PWMP) is to create a framework to evaluate the safety and efficacy of pharmacologic agents for the treatment of obesity or overweight in pediatric participants.
Treatments tested
- Orforglipron also known as LY3502970 Drug
Administered orally. ISA specific interventions will be listed in the ISA.
- Placebo Drug
Administered orally. ISA specific interventions will be listed in the ISA.
